Security Screening

Security Lines

TSA security lines can be long at DFW. Arrive early and allow ample time to pass through security.

TSA PreCheck

If you are TSA PreCheck enrolled, you can enjoy expedited screening. This means you can keep your shoes on, leave your liquids in your bag, and use a dedicated lane for faster processing.

Security Procedures

Follow TSA guidelines. Be prepared to remove electronics, jackets, and belts. Liquids must be in 3.4 ounce containers and placed in a clear bag. Be aware of prohibited items such as knives and weapons.
